Purpose of Position Assists in a variety of surgical procedures/operations under the direct supervision of the surgeon and registered nurse.

Description Demonstrates a good technical knowledge of the surgical environment, principles of infection control and sterility and uses this knowledge in assisting the Registered Nurse and Surgeon to provide a safe surgical environment which supports quality patient care. Prepares the operating room by setting up surgical instruments and equipment, sterile drapes and sterile solutions. Maintains a sterile environment according to hospital policy and AORN Standards of Care. Able to perform the scrub technician functions for all services and specialties. Assembles sterile and non-sterile equipment and adjusts as necessary to ensure proper working condition. During surgery passes instruments, and other sterile supplies to surgeon and surgeon's assistants. Holds retractors, cuts sutures, helps count sponges, needles, supplies and instruments. Prepares, cares for, and disposes of specimens taken for laboratory analysis. Assists in applying surgical dressings. Ensures availability of surgeon and case specific instrumentation and equipment following department protocol and surgeon's preference cards. Assists in transporting patients to the Operating Room and helps position patients on the Operating Room table. Understands and uses the appropriate sterilization methods for special equipment and instruments. Understands the specific use and functioning of all supplies and equipment used in surgical procedures. May operate sterilizers. Lights, suction, and help with diagnostic equipment. Under the direction of the surgeon and Registered Nurse, accurately and safely prepares and labels medications during the "surgical procedure." Assists in transferring patients to the recovery area. May assist in turnover and restocking the operating room for the next surgical procedure. Respects patients' inherent right to privacy, dignity and safety. Provides a safe environment for the surgical patient. Assumes responsibility for orientation of new Operating Room employees, as required. Understands the importance of teamwork, consideration and cooperation. Works in conjunction with Registered Nurse to update and maintain equipment and instrumentation of specialty services. Participates in unit staff meetings, in-service programs and educational programs relative to career development. Qualifications Surgical Technologist - Grade: S13, Job Code: 7107 Ability to read, write and communicate in English Graduate of an Accredited Civilian or Military Operating Room Technologist/Surgical Technologist program (BLS) - Basic Life Support certification (obtain within 90 days, offered within) Must meet at least one of the following qualifications: Must obtain National Certification within 12 months of graduation and maintain certification Have been employed as a Surgical Technologist in a surgical facility on July 1, 2013 and become certified within one year of start date and maintain certification Have successfully completed a training program for Surgical Technology in the Army, Navy, Air Force, Marine Corps or Coast Guard of the United States or in the United States Public Health Service which has been deemed appropriate by the commissioner and become certified within one year of start date and maintain certification Surgical Technologist (Certified) - Grade: S14, Job Code: 7109 Ability to read, write and communicate in English Graduate of an Accredited Civilian or Military Operating Room Technologist/Surgical Technologist program Certified by an entity accredited by the National Commission for Certifying Agencies and which is also recognized by both the American College of Surgeons and the Association of Surgical Technologists and must maintain certification (BLS) - Basic Life Support certification (obtain within 90 days, offered within)
